Signs that You Have Poor Indoor Air Quality

There are various things that can go wrong with your indoor air quality. The modern home is tightly sealed against the elements so that we can have maximum control over our indoor climates and preserve the best possible energy efficiency. But the downside of this approach to our buildings is that contaminants such as dust, dander, mold spores, mildew and bacteria can get trapped within and continue to recirculate over and over. A whole house indoor air quality device may be your best means of improving your indoor air quality. The whole house air filtration systems that we install and service may be just what you need if you find yourself with poor indoor air quality. They are highly effective and require very little to no maintenance.

An alternative to an air filtration system is the air purifier, which uses an electro–static charge to cause noxious particles to adhere to a collector plate or cell within the device. Your indoor air is thus thoroughly cleaned without any airflow blockage that could raise the cost of your heating and cooling.

Another sort of air purifier is the UV air purifier, which uses ultraviolet light in order to remove the presence of biological contaminants such as mold and mildew. We install and service these units in addition to others.

If you find that your energy bills are higher than they should be or you notice a whistling sound coming from your ductwork, then you could probably benefit from our duct sealing service. We use only professional materials and techniques to ensure that your ducts are taken care of.
